Output 24012367316a9de85daf2bbd6314c32ff3637e06e6b855f0116009d709b28f25:1

value
2025545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42551f8be2b4493cf7c662f97e3e6d26e92e4b55 OP_EQUALVERIFY OP_CHECKSIG
address
173ja8LBnTEndpQjp5rC3Eum7H54RFY61p
transaction
24012367316a9de85daf2bbd6314c32ff3637e06e6b855f0116009d709b28f25
spent
true